My honest opinion. 💡 30-Day REAL Analysis The iPhone 17 Pro Max is Apple's most refined smartphone yet, but it also has some annoying details in daily use. The new Dynamic Island 2.0 is more fluid and useful, with direct integration with Apple Intelligence, and the 2500-nit brightness is incredible outdoors. But the polished titanium finish—beautiful—is also a magnet for micro-scratches. Yes, the iPhone 17 scratches easily, and I demonstrate this up close in the video. The A19 Pro is a machine. The fluidity, multitasking, and temperature control are exemplary—no thermal throttling even during long 4K60 recordings. iOS 26 brought incredible native AI features, but also some initial bugs (which have already begun to be fixed with updates). The cameras follow Apple's standards: color balance, impeccable HDR, and even more natural nighttime performance. The telephoto lens has improved sharpness, and AI-powered portrait mode now better understands depth and lighting. The battery? Better than the 16 Pro Max, but far from miraculous — an average of 4 hours of active screen time. And the sound? Loud, balanced, and with more bass — Apple's stereo audio is still the benchmark. ⚖️ Positives ✅ Premium and lightweight design (real titanium) ✅ Incredibly consistent cameras ✅ A19 Pro performance ✅ Fluid iOS 26 with AI features ✅ Powerful and clear stereo sound ✅ Impressive display with extreme brightness 🔍 Final Verdict After 30 days of using the iPhone 17 Pro Max, I can say it's the best iPhone ever made, but it's not for everyone. If you have an iPhone 15 or 16 Pro, it might not be worth the upgrade right now. But if you're coming from a previous model, the leap in performance, cameras, and display is dramatic.
